Weight loss stories, motivation, tips, and general conversation around the process of improving our bodies and our minds. The host shares his personal journey of losing 125 pounds over two years and is dedicated to helping others achieve their goals.

10 Reasons You're Not Changing (And Don't Want To) - 257 Jun 12, 2026 00:19:34 Join the Guildwww.imnotquitting.com ---Dieting isn't changing. Dieting is a temporary thing you do to make your body smaller. But your body got bigger for a reason — your lifestyle, your habits, your routines, your environment, your community, your belief systems. Change those, and the weight follows.
